Premier League Fixtures To Be Released Thursday Morning.
Wednesday, 19th Aug 2020 18:18

Saints fans will finally find out where and when the club will be playing during season 2020/21 some 2 1/2 months after the original schedule was due to be released, however how many of them they will actually be able to gain admittance to is another question.

The new Premier League season is just over three weeks away and it will finally feel within touching distance on Thursday morning 20th August as the 2020/21 fixtures are released at 9am BST.

There will be 380 matches in total and Saints will be taking part in 38 of them, usually this would be the date when supporters across the country would be able to plan their weekend schedules etc to some degree, but for the first month at least there will be no supporters allowed into the games, the second month will hopefully see a return although only with a limited capacity and then after that it is unclear what will happen.

One thing that is unlikely much before Xmas, is that fans will be allowed to travel away to see their team.

It is also unclear how many of the games will be televised, will it be the normal number or will there be measures put in place so that fans can see the games they can't get into.

The likelihood here is that clubs will be able to put in place some sort of streaming of live games for their home fixtures but not the away one.

Anyway not long to go now and at 9am 20th August the fixture list will be released across media outlets and a small step toward footballing normality will seem a little nearer.
